CFNU is encouraged by capital funding for health infrastructure and supports for IENs promised in Budget 2025. While Canada’s nurses support these efforts, the budget ignored the urgent need for nurse retention & recruitment and did not offer any new funding for pharmacare agreements. (1/2) #cdnpoli

An Ontario’s Financial Accountability Office report reveals that if the Ford government fails to improve health-care funding, 7,263 nurses could be cut by 2027-28, worsening Ontario’s nurses per capita.

Early this morning, the Alberta government fast-tracked legislation imposing a collective agreement on striking teachers and invoked the notwithstanding clause of the Canadian Charter of Rights and Freedoms to shield the law from court challenges for the duration of the 4-year deal. (1/2) #canlab
